Regulatory Environment of Online Gambling in Thailand
Thailand has strict laws governing gambling, and the online realm is no exception. The government has in place stringent regulations aimed at curbing all forms of gambling, including activities on online platforms. It is essential to acknowledge that partaking in online gambling within Thailand is unlawful. The authorities have shown a propensity to crack down on both operators and players, resulting in significant risks and potential repercussions. Implications on the Population
The prohibition of online gambling in Thailand has led many individuals to search for alternative options, often resorting to offshore gambling websites. However, utilizing unregulated offshore platforms exposes participants to the risk of scams and fraudulent activities. Moreover, individuals caught engaging in online gambling might face severe penalties, including monetary fines and imprisonment. Advocating for Reforms
The stringent gambling laws in Thailand have sparked ongoing discussions regarding potential revisions. Advocates argue that legalizing and regulating online gambling could yield substantial economic benefits, including amplified tax revenue and job creation. Additionally, by establishing a framework to oversee online gambling activities, the government could provide enhanced protection for players, ensuring fairness and responsible gambling practices. Proponents of reforms maintain that a fresh approach to online gambling laws could yield positive outcomes for both the government and its citizens.
